Plumbing Service Built for San Juan's Climate and Soil Conditions
San Juan sits in the heart of the Rio Grande Valley on expansive clay soils that present one of the most difficult environments for plumbing infrastructure in the state. The region's clay expands dramatically during the wet season and contracts in dry periods, and that constant movement puts stress on the slab foundations that are standard throughout San Juan. Slab-on-grade construction means all supply lines and drain pipes run beneath or through the concrete, making a leak harder to detect and more disruptive to repair than in homes with accessible crawl spaces. South Texas summers are long and intensely hot, with temperature and humidity spikes during storm season that accelerate pipe material degradation - plastic pipe, rubber gaskets, and flexible connectors all degrade faster under sustained heat above 100 degrees. The Rio Grande Valley also receives hard water with elevated mineral content that deposits scale inside water heaters and supply lines at a rate that noticeably shortens equipment life without regular maintenance. Plumbing and Drains
San Juan's expansive clay soils place continuous shifting forces on the drain lines embedded in or beneath slab foundations. Over time, joints separate and pipes crack, causing slow leaks that erode the soil under the slab and eventually create settlement issues. Above the slab, grease buildup in kitchen drains and mineral scaling from the region's hard water restrict flow in fixture lines and main drain runs. Water Heater Installation and Service
San Juan's hot climate and hard water create a specific set of water heater challenges. High mineral content in the Rio Grande Valley's water supply accelerates sediment buildup at the bottom of tank-style water heaters, reducing efficiency and shortening equipment life. Homes in San Juan can also benefit from tankless systems, which perform efficiently in the mild South Texas winter and eliminate standby heat loss year-round. Water Heaters - Repair and Maintenance
Not every water heater problem requires a full replacement. San Juan homeowners dealing with inconsistent water temperature, delayed hot water delivery, or discolored output may have a repairable issue - a faulty thermostat, a corroded anode rod, or excessive sediment that can be flushed without replacing the tank. What is backflow prevention and why is it important in San Juan?
Backflow occurs when contaminated water reverses direction and flows back into the clean water supply, typically caused by sudden pressure drops from a main break or high demand. In San Juan, where agricultural chemicals and irrigation water are present near residential and commercial areas, backflow prevention is critical for protecting drinking water quality. How often should I schedule drain cleaning in San Juan?
We recommend having main sewer lines inspected and cleaned every 18 to 24 months, particularly if your property has mature trees nearby. Kitchen drains should be professionally cleaned annually due to the area's hard water, which compounds grease buildup with mineral scale. How can I protect my plumbing during hurricane season in San Juan?
Before hurricane season begins in June, have your sewer lines inspected and cleaned to ensure maximum drainage capacity. Clear all exterior drains and downspouts of debris. Know the location of your main water shutoff valve so you can turn it off quickly if needed. Install backflow prevention devices to keep storm water from entering your plumbing system. San Juan's flat terrain makes flood preparedness especially important. After any significant storm, have your plumbing inspected for damage. What causes sewer line problems in San Juan?
The most common causes are tree root intrusion and soil movement. Roots seek out moisture inside sewer lines through small cracks or separated joints, growing until the line clogs completely. Expansive clay soil shifts with seasonal moisture changes, cracking pipes and creating entry points. Grease buildup, storm debris, and aging pipe materials like clay tile or cast iron also contribute. The flat terrain and high water table in the Rio Grande Valley compound these issues by slowing natural drainage.
